Hawks trade Dedmon to Pistons for Snell, Thomas

The Detroit Pistons acquired center Dewayne Dedmon from the Atlanta Hawks in exchange for wing Tony Snell and guard Khyri Thomas, the Pistons announced Friday.

Dedmon split last season between Atlanta and the Sacramento Kings. He averaged 5.8 points and 5.7 rebounds across 44 combined appearances. The 7-foot center has two years and $26.6 million remaining on his deal, though the final year is only partially guaranteed.

Snell registered eight points per contest and shot 40.2% from distance during his lone season in the Motor City. The 29-year-old will be an unrestricted free agent after the 2020-21 campaign.

Atlanta will waive Thomas, according to Sarah K. Spencer of The Atlanta Journal-Constitution. Thomas has only made 34 appearances over the past two seasons. The Philadelphia 76ers drafted him 38th overall in 2018.
